Arrest of OGDCL officials real kidnappers demanded

KARAK - Khattak tribe has expressed dissatisfaction over the investigations of the released OGDCL official and has demanded the immediate arrest of the real kidnappers. The tribe will also hold a protest meeting at Shaheedan against the non-arrest of the kidnappers. This demand came in a meeting of the elders of Chountra held here on Sunday at the hometown Shaheedan of the recently released Chief Metroelogist of OGDCL Rahmatullah Khattak from the captivity of the kidnappers and the elders showed complete dissatisfaction over the so far investigations carried out by the SSP (Investigation) Kohat through investigation officer Saifullah. They alleged that the Kohat police were deliberately changing the direction of the investigations in wrong side just to provide security to the real culprits and said that the change of the investigation officer was an alarming sign. Addressing the meeting, the former district Naib Nazim and existing district bar association president advocate Jan Alam said that the entire government machinery was well aware that who were involved in the kidnapping of the OGDCL official and alleged that the Kohat and Karak police were involved in the kidnapping. He recalled that the kidnapping of Rahmatullah was not the first incident of kidnapping from the areas and informed that some time ago the two officials of OGDCL had also been kidnapped from the Kohat district who had been allegedly released on ransom. The district bar president said that the Karak and Kohat districts were rich in oil and gas resources and the OGDCL was playing a very pivotal role in the development of the areas but the kidnapping of the its officials was a very profile incident and it should be taken serious. He underlined the need that such incidents should not be occurred in future and added for stopping such incidents in future the investigations of the Rahmatullah kidnapping case should be put on right direction. He categorically stated that expectations of transparent investigations from the SSP Attequllah Wazeer was not possible as his involvement with the kidnappers show his links with the militants. He said that the culprits involved in the kidnapping of the OGDCL how might be influential should be brought to the justice without any delay and he also showed deep concerns over the involvement of some local people in the kidnapping of the company official. The meeting demanded that all those involved in the kidnapping of Rahmatullah should be disclosed by the police and those local people who were found guilty their houses should be set on fire as they were involved in inhuman activities. Former district Councillor Shafeer Khattak on the occasion said that 50 percent investigations had been completed by the statements of the kidnapped official and the remaining 50 percent investigations should be completed by the police in right direction as some of names of the kidnapers had been revealed by the arrested kidnapper Raham Daraz. He criticised the investigation officer Saifullah for putting the investigation in wrong direction to provide security to the real culprits. He cautioned if the real culprits were not brought to justice then it would become a routine job and nobody would be secured in the district. After discussion it was unanimously decided that on Monday (today) a protest meeting would be held at Shaheedan and the people of entire Chountra would participate in the meeting to press the government for the arrest of the real culprits.
